Broasted chicken with rice and curry. Broasting is a method of cooking chicken and other foods using a pressure fryer technique invented by L. A. M. Phelan and marketed by the Broaster Company. [10] The method essentially combines pressure cooking with deep frying to pressure fry chicken that has been marinated and breaded.

In the early 1950s, approximately the same time as Colonel Harlan Sanders began franchising his KFC restaurant chain, Phelan developed the broasting method of cooking chicken, for which he invented a modified commercial-grade pressure cooker. [clarification needed] He founded the Broaster Company in 1954 to manufacture and market the machines.
